Title:
ドライブプレートトルク計の構造最適設計方法
Document Type and Number:
Japanese Patent JP7175824
Kind Code:
B2
Abstract:
To perform measurement in such a manner that a result can be regarded equal to a behavior of an original engine even if an original drive plate is replaced with a newly designed drive plate torquemeter.SOLUTION: An optimal structure design method for a drive plate torquemeter executes the steps of: designing a shape in which dimensions of an inner coupling part, an outer coupling part and an outer peripheral ring gear parts of an original drive plate are matched, by a computer; providing a strain induction part which senses a torque, at an outer peripheral side of the inner coupling part; and optimizing the shape on the basis of such restriction items that mass and inertia moments are settled within predetermined ranges, while defining a space from an outer peripheral side of the strain induction part to an inner peripheral side of the ring gear part as a free design region.SELECTED DRAWING: Figure 2
